I'd like to enter my 2002 Kawasaki zx7r, please.
Before Pictures:
When purchased from previous owner in NJ, July 2010 (pics taken the day after I picked her up):
Since then, I’ve been busy. All work/modifications (painting, carbon fiber fab, hydro-dipping, electrical, mechanical, etc.), everything, was completed by yours truly.
Performance mods:
Full Gen III (’08 -’10) zx10r wheel and suspension swap, from the triple tree front, and the swingarm pivot back (complete with Racetech G2R fork cartridge kit)
Repacked and rebadged Muzzy full system
Braided Stainless Steel front and rear brake lines
K&N air filter
Factory Pro stage 1 jet kit
Factory Pro shift kit
“float bowl mod” along with Muzzy block-off plates
Renthal -1/+2 sprockets
Renthal SRS Road Chain
Visual/Functional mods:
Sharkskins solo tail
Undertail
Koso RX2-GP gauge cluster
Integrated tail light
Flush mount turn signals
HID projectors
Gilles Tooling rearsets
Lockhart Phillips carbon fiber frame and swingarm sliders
Handmade (wet layup) carbon fiber front sprocket cover and coolant bottle cover
SSR fuel cap
… That’s not everything, but most of it.
